Output 8940b1083868a70d1119c29ccad8bfcaaf9cf841ce148e04bac1b9767c559495:7

value
18436779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c92f141eedf000acd11ab5ec8a0997d17baad4e5 OP_EQUAL
address
3L2n9BPY83hQS1ghQ4zhErXseAUFf8Hih1
transaction
8940b1083868a70d1119c29ccad8bfcaaf9cf841ce148e04bac1b9767c559495
spent
true